Scampi with Roasted Red Peppers and Olives Recipe

Ingredients with Measurements:
- 1 pound of scampi, peeled and deveined
- 1/4 cup of olive oil
- 1/4 cup of white wine
- 1/4 cup of chicken broth
- 1/4 cup of chopped roasted red peppers
- 1/4 cup of sliced kalamata olives
- 2 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1/2 teaspoon of red pepper flakes
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ish

Special equipment needed:
- Large skillet
- Oven-safe dish

Step-by-step instructions:

1. Preheat the oven to 375°F.

2.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at.

3. Add the scampi to the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until they turn pink.

4. Remove the scampi from the skillet and transfer them to an oven-safe dish.

5. In the same skillet, add the white wine, chicken broth, roasted red peppers, kalamata olives, garlic,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per.

6. Cook the mixture over medium-high heat for 5-7 minutes until the sauce has thickened.

7. Pour the sauce over the scampi in the oven-safe dish.

8. Bake the scampi in the oven for 10-12 minutes until they are fully cooked.

9.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.


Time:
Preparation time: 15 minutes
Cooking time: 20-25 minutes
Temperature:
Preheat the oven to 375°F.
Serving size:
This recipe serves 4 people.

Substitutions for ingredients:
- Shrimp can be used instead of scampi.
- Vegetable broth can be used instead of chicken broth.
- Green olives can be used instead of kalamata olives.

Variations:
- Add chopped tomatoes to the sauce for a fresher taste.
- Use different herbs such as basil or oregano for a different flavor profile.

Tips and tricks:
- Make sure to not overcook the scampi as they can become tough.
- Use fresh parsley for the best flavor and presentation.

Storage instructions:
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Reheating instructions:
Reheat the scampi in the oven at 375°F for 10-12 minutes until heated through.

Presentation ideas:
Serve the scampi on a bed of rice or pasta for a complete meal.

Garnishes:
Fresh parsley can be used as a garnish.

Pairings:
This dish pairs well with a crisp white wine such as Sauvignon Blanc.

Suggested side dishes:
- Garlic bread
- Roasted vegetables
- Caesar salad

Troubleshooting advice:
- If the sauce is too thick, add more chicken broth or white wine to thin it out.
- If the scampi is overcooked, it can become tough and chewy.

Food safety advice:
- Make sure to properly clean and devein the scampi before cooking.
- Cook the scampi to an internal temperature of 145°F to ensure they are fully cooked.
